Auer (also known as Ora in Italian) is a lovely wine village with more than 3,000 inhabitants nestled in the Castelfeder holiday region. Although the people no longer live exclusively off agriculture, the place has been able to preserve its rural charm and there are historic residences and farms in the Mediterranean style, narrow lanes lined by natural stone walls, trees and flowers wherever you look.
Auer is situated in the fertile Etsch valley, at a slight elevation of 250 metres above sea level. Shops, cafés and cosy guesthouses lend the place a pleasant atmosphere that you will enjoy soaking up.

Highlights in Auer:
- Schwarzenbach sports and recreation area
- Church of St Peter with the oldest organ in the whole of the Alps
- Auer Castle
- Baumgarten Castle
- Ruins of Leiter Castle
- Katzenleiter trail
- Waterfall
